New garage door installation in Dallas, Texas

A replacement door is a measuring job before it is a shopping decision. Opening width, headroom, backroom and the weight of the door chosen all decide what track and what spring the installation needs.

In older Dallas neighbourhoods the header and jambs are frequently older than the door hanging on them, so the structure gets checked before anything gets quoted. Steel thickness on a door is given as a gauge number, and a lower number means thicker steel. A single layer door has one skin doing all the structural work, so gauge is the main thing separating a light panel from one that resists a knock. Thin skins also drum more when the door runs, since there is no core damping the panel. Garages of the 1920s and 1940s were closed by doors that swung out or slid sideways, so the space above the opening was never kept clear. An up and over door needs it, both headroom for the curve in the track and backroom the depth of the door. Collar ties and open rafters often run exactly where the horizontal track belongs. An 8 foot wide opening was the common single car size for decades, but 9 feet is now the more usual stock width, so an 8 foot door can be a build to order size rather than one held on a shelf. Two 8 foot doors side by side also load the center post, which carries vertical track for both and needs checking before either door is hung. Openings framed in the 1960s sit in a two by four wall, and the jamb was often one board deep, enough for a thin one piece door and no more. A sectional wants jamb depth behind the stop molding for the track brackets and for roller travel, so those jambs are usually furred out with new stock before track goes on.

Stiffness in a single layer door comes from its shape rather than its mass. The stamped rib or raised panel pattern folds the steel so it resists bending along the length of the section, and the end stiles carry the hinges and rollers at each edge. Flat pan designs lose that folded geometry and depend more on struts to stay straight.

A single door replacement is a half day, two doors a full day. A one piece tilt up door swings out on a pivot hinge and needs clear space in front of the opening as it lifts. Replacing it with a sectional changes the hardware entirely: vertical and horizontal track go in, the jambs usually need new wood to mount that track, and a torsion shaft is mounted above the header. The old pivot hardware comes off.

Detached alley garages in the older neighbourhoods often have no opener at all, or one added decades later with improvised bracing. A detached garage often has no dedicated circuit, so an opener needs a grounded receptacle near the ceiling rather than an extension lead run from the house. The building matters as much as the wiring. A slab that has settled leaves the opening out of square, and a light framed wall may need blocking added before spring anchor hardware is bolted to it.
